3 روش تبدیل هگزادسیمال به دوتایی یا دهدهی

فهرست مطالب:

3 روش تبدیل هگزادسیمال به دوتایی یا دهدهی
3 روش تبدیل هگزادسیمال به دوتایی یا دهدهی

تصویری: 3 روش تبدیل هگزادسیمال به دوتایی یا دهدهی

تصویری: 3 روش تبدیل هگزادسیمال به دوتایی یا دهدهی
تصویری: ‫🔴 آموزش نمودار Cash Flow یا جریان نقدینگی در اکسل 2024, ممکن است
Anonim

چگونه می توانید آن اعداد و حروف خنده دار را به چیزی تبدیل کنید که شما یا رایانه شما می توانید درک کنید؟ تبدیل هگزادسیمال به باینری بسیار آسان است ، به همین دلیل است که هگزادسیمال در چندین زبان برنامه نویسی به کار گرفته شده است. تبدیل به اعشار کمی پیچیده تر است ، اما وقتی به نتیجه رسیدید ، به راحتی می توانید هر عددی را تکرار کنید.

گام

روش 1 از 3: تبدیل هگزادسیمال به دودویی

مرحله 1. هر رقم هگزادسیمال را به چهار رقم دوتایی تبدیل کنید

هگزادسیمال در ابتدا پذیرفته شد زیرا تبدیل بین هگزادسیمال و باینری بسیار آسان بود. در اصل ، هگزادسیمال به عنوان راهی برای نمایش اطلاعات دوتایی در توالی های کوتاهتر استفاده می شود. این جدول به شما در تبدیل از یکی به دیگری کمک می کند:

هگزا دسیمال دودویی
0 0000
1 0001
2 0010
3 0011
4 0100
5 0101
6 0110
7 0111
8 1000
9 1001
آ 1010
ب 1011
ج 1100
د 1101
ه 1110
اف 1111

مرحله 2. خودتان آن را امتحان کنید

این به سادگی تبدیل یک رقم به چهار رقم معادل دوتایی آن ساده است. در اینجا چند عدد شش ضلعی است که می خواهید تبدیل کنید. برای مشاهده کار خود ، متن نامرئی را در سمت راست علامت مساوی مسدود کنید:

  • A23 = 1010 0010 0011
  • زنبور عسل = 1011 1110 1110
  • 70C558 = 0111 0000 1100 0101 0101 1000

مرحله 3. نحوه عملکرد آن را درک کنید

در سیستم دوتایی پایه دو ، از رقم دودویی n می توان برای نشان دادن 2 استفاده کرد n اعداد مختلف به عنوان مثال ، با چهار رقم باینری ، می توانید 2 را نشان دهید4 = 16 عدد مختلف از آنجا که هگزادسیمال یک سیستم شانزده پایه است ، می توان از یک عدد تک رقمی برای نشان دادن 16 استفاده کرد1 = 16 عدد مختلف این امر تبدیل بین دو سیستم را بسیار آسان می کند.

همچنین می توانید تصور کنید که سیستم محاسباتی در حال تبدیل شدن به رقم های دیگر است. شمارش هگزا دسیمال … D ، E ، F ، 10'' ، در همان زمان ، تعداد دودویی 1101 ، 1110 ، 1111 ، 10000''.

روش 2 از 3: تبدیل هگزادسیمال به دهدهی

1797961 6 1
1797961 6 1

مرحله 1. نحوه عملکرد پایه ده را مرور کنید

شما هر روز از علامت اعشاری بدون نیاز به توقف استفاده می کنید و به معنای آن فکر نمی کنید. با این حال ، وقتی اولین بار آن را یاد گرفتید ، والدین یا معلمان شما ممکن است آن را با جزئیات بیشتری برای شما توضیح داده باشند. بررسی سریع نحوه نوشتن اعداد معمولی به شما در تبدیل اعداد کمک می کند:

  • هر رقم در یک عدد اعشاری در مکان خاصی قرار دارد. از چپ به راست ، مکانهای یکتایی ، ده ها مکان ، صدها مکان و غیره وجود دارد. رقم 3 فقط در صورتی که در جای یک باشد ، به معنی 3 است ، اما وقتی در مکان دهها قرار دارد نشان دهنده 30 و در مکان صدها عدد 300 است.
  • از نظر ریاضی ، مکان نشان دهنده 10 است0, 101, 102، و سپس به همین دلیل است که این سیستم مبنای ده یا اعشار از کلمه لاتین دهم نامیده می شود.
1797961 7 1
1797961 7 1

مرحله 2. عدد اعشاری را به عنوان یک مسئله جمع بنویسید

این ممکن است بدیهی به نظر برسد ، اما این همان روندی است که ما برای تبدیل اعداد هگزادسیمال از آن استفاده می کنیم ، بنابراین نقطه شروع خوبی است. بیایید عدد 480.137 را دوباره بنویسیم10به (به یاد داشته باشید ، مشترک شوید 10 به ما می گوید که عدد در مبنای ده نوشته شده است.):

  • با شروع از راست ترین رقم ، 7 = 7 10 100، یا 1 7 7
  • در سمت چپ ، 3 = 3 10 101، یا 10 * 3
  • با تکرار همه ارقام ، 480،137 = 4x100،000 + 8x10،000 + 0x1،000 + 1x100 + 3x10 + 7x1 به دست می آوریم.
1797961 8 1
1797961 8 1

مرحله 3. مقدار مکان را در کنار عدد هگزا دسیمال بنویسید

از آنجا که هگزادسیمال پایه شانزده است ، ارزش مکان مطابق با قدرت شانزده است. برای تبدیل به اعشار ، هر مقدار مکان را در رقم شانزدهم مربوط ضرب کنید. این فرآیند را با نوشتن قدرت شانزده در کنار ارقام عدد هگزا دسیمال شروع کنید. ما این کار را برای عدد هگزادسیمال C921 انجام می دهیم16به از 16 سمت چپ شروع کنید0، و هر بار که به چپ به رقم بعدی حرکت می کنید ، قدرت را افزایش دهید:

  • 116 = 1 16 160 = 1 x 1 (همه اعداد به صورت اعشاری هستند مگر اینکه موارد دیگری ذکر شده باشد.)
  • 216 = 2 16 161 = 2 16 16
  • 916 = 16 9 92 = 9 25 256
  • C = C x 163 = C x 4096
1797961 9 1
1797961 9 1

مرحله 4. تبدیل حروف الفبا به اعشاری

ارقام یک عدد به صورت اعشاری یا هگزادسیمال است ، بنابراین نیازی به تغییر آنها ندارید (برای مثال ، 716 = 710) برای تبدیل حروف الفبا به این لیست مراجعه کنید تا آنها را به معادل اعشاری تبدیل کنید:

  • A = 10
  • B = 11
  • C = 12 (ما در مثال بالا از این مورد استفاده خواهیم کرد.)
  • D = 13
  • E = 14
  • F = 15
1797961 10 1
1797961 10 1

مرحله 5. محاسبات را انجام دهید

حالا که همه چیز به صورت اعشاری نوشته شده است ، هر مسئله ضرب را انجام دهید و نتایج را جمع کنید. ماشین حساب می تواند برای اکثر اعداد هگزا دسیمال کمک کند. در ادامه مثال قبلی ما ، در اینجا C921 به عنوان یک فرمول اعشاری نوشته شده و حل شده است:

  • C92116 = (به صورت اعشاری) (1 1 1) + (2 16 16) + (9 25 256) + (12 40 4096)
  • = 1 + 32 + 2.304 + 49.152.
  • = 51.48910به نسخه اعشاری معمولاً دارای ارقام بیشتری نسبت به نسخه هگزادسیمال است ، زیرا هگزادسیمال می تواند اطلاعات بیشتری را در هر رقم ذخیره کند.
1797961 11 1
1797961 11 1

مرحله 6. تبدیل را تمرین کنید

در اینجا تعدادی اعداد برای تبدیل از هگزا دسیمال به اعشاری آورده شده است. پس از محاسبه پاسخ ، متن نامرئی را در سمت راست علامت مساوی مسدود کنید تا کار خود را بررسی کنید:

  • 3AB16 = 93910
  • A1A116 = 4137710
  • 500016 = 2048010
  • 500D16 = 2049310
  • 18A2F16 = 10091110

روش 3 از 3: درک مبانی هگزادسیمال

1797961 1
1797961 1

مرحله 1. نحوه استفاده از هگزادسیمال را بدانید

سیستم محاسبه اعشاری معمولی ما بر اساس ده است و از ده نماد مختلف برای نشان دادن اعداد استفاده می کند. هگزادسیمال یک سیستم عددی شانزده پایه است ، بدین معنا که از شانزده کاراکتر برای نمایش اعداد استفاده می کند.

  • شمارش از صفر به بالا:

    هگزا دسیمال اعشاری هگزا دسیمال اعشاری
    0 0 10 16
    1 1 11 17
    2 2 12 18
    3 3 13 19
    4 4 14 20
    5 5 15 21
    6 6 16 22
    7 7 17 23
    8 8 18 24
    9 9 19 25
    آ 10 1A 26
    ب 11 1B 27
    ج 12 1C 28
    د 13 1D 29
    ه 14 1E 30
    اف 15 1F 31
1797961 2
1797961 2

مرحله 2. از یک زیرنویس برای نشان دادن سیستم مورد استفاده خود استفاده کنید

اگر سیستم مورد استفاده شما واضح نیست ، از یک عدد پیش نویس اعشاری برای نشان دادن پایه استفاده کنید. به عنوان مثال ، 1710 به معنی هفده پایه ده (عدد اعشاری معمولی) است. 1110 = 1016، زیرا 10 نحوه نوشتن عدد یازده به صورت هگزادسیمال (پایه شانزده) است. اگر این عدد دارای حروف الفبا مانند B یا E. باشد ، می توانید این مرحله را رد کنید. هیچ کس آن را با عدد اعشاری اشتباه نمی گیرد.

نکات

  • برای تبدیل اعداد هگزا دسیمال به یک ماشین حساب آنلاین برای تبدیل به اعشار نیاز است. همچنین می توانید از این کار صرف نظر کرده و از یک ابزار تبدیل آنلاین برای انجام آن استفاده کنید ، اگرچه درک نحوه عملکرد این فرایند ایده خوبی است.
  • شما می توانید تبدیل هگزادسیمال به اعشاری را برای تبدیل هر سیستم عددی مبتنی بر x به اعشاری سفارشی کنید. فقط قدرت شانزده را با توان x جایگزین کنید. سعی کنید سیستم محاسبه 60 بابلی را یاد بگیرید!

توصیه شده: